DISABLED: UN RIGHTS AGREEMENT DOES NOT PREVENT ABORTION, DO NOT SIGN VATICAN (ASCA) - Citta 'del Vaticano, 2 December -
The Holy See has not signed, and does not intend to sign,''the UN Convention on the Rights of Persons with disabilities'''entry into force on 8 May this year.
refusal, already 'announced during the drafting of the Convention, it was confirmed today at ASCO on the eve of International Day of People with disabilities', promoted by the UN on the issue''Dignity' and justice for all of us''by sources of the Pontifical Council for Health Pastoral Care. ''Our position has not 'changed,''explained the Vatican department.
The UN Convention on the Rights of the disabled and 'the first human rights treaty of the third millennium and it' been approved by the UN General Assembly in 2006.
The Holy See has participated actively in the work for the drafting of the text, which lasted five years but in the end, and 'refused to sign it 'cause it does not contain an express prohibition against abortion.
http://www.asca.it/moddettnews.php?i ...%% 20NON 20FIRMA
The Convention, with its 50 articles, sets out in detail the rights of persons with disabilities.
It deals, among other things, civil and political rights, accessibility, participation, right to education, health, employment and social protection.
